
I can’t be snarky about this at all. I can barely bring myself to write about Amy Winehouse these days; she’s such a talented young woman so close to death. Her mother sees that, too, and has published an open letter in News of the World to her daughter, as a last-ditch effort to reach out to her self-destructing daughter. The whole letter is heartbreaking.
Says her mum:
I hope it makes you realise that although you might be a superstar, you’re not superwoman.
Early fame has overwhelmed you, it’s dizzied you and muddled your mind. For a moment, forget you’re a superstar. You’re also young and vulnerable. Remember you’re just an ordinary human being, no stronger than any of the rest of us. You think you’re strong enough to get through this on your own, darling, but you’re not.
